Originally by: Rushnik Make your idea less vague with an application in the eve universe.
They are meant to be used to defend gates, both allies and enemies will be hit with them, they can be anchored, targeted and destroyed as with MWDB, or you can simply throw a few suicide frigates or drones at them to set the field off. These are not the old single placement mines. They are a Minefield, a bubble of space where there are mines, entering that area sets them off, dealing damage to everything in the bubble, the bubble would be just a graphic showing the outline of the field, maybe just a sphere of red dots or something simple, no need for distortion field used with the MWDBs. Meant to be used with MWDBs, to so a target can't just warp out. The image I have of them is put two bubbles up covering most of the gate area in an anti warp field, around the edges of the warp bubbles place minefields, so exiting the bubble means entering the minefield. The reason for a new weapon system is to just shake up 0.0 alliances, old tactics are old, add something new into the mix. Supercaps would find it hard to enter the system when their cyno ships can't make it past the gates. Open the cyno in the bubble? Sure, then the cap will bounce off the gate straight into the minefields.
